)]}'
{
  "commit": "0792c32e8fe0dc3da193b49f845bb6e45401b00e",
  "tree": "79974cfdfbf163a51992f5f2af15e81aaf530480",
  "parents": [
    "c3a3a24a87338fbe65b1a137bb9b086fdd3b63bd"
  ],
  "author": {
    "name": "scottb@google.com",
    "email": "scottb@google.com@8db76d5a-ed1c-0410-87a9-c151d255dfc7",
    "time": "Thu Apr 03 02:57:30 2008 +0000"
  },
  "committer": {
    "name": "scottb@google.com",
    "email": "scottb@google.com@8db76d5a-ed1c-0410-87a9-c151d255dfc7",
    "time": "Thu Apr 03 02:57:30 2008 +0000"
  },
  "message": "Manually replacing / 2\u0027s with \u003e\u003e 1\u0027s as this generates more optimal code in web mode because we don\u0027t have to coerce the result to integer.  However, it\u0027s only safe for non-negative numbers because shifting doesn\u0027t round correctly.\n\nReview by: knorton (desk check)\n\n\ngit-svn-id: https://google-web-toolkit.googlecode.com/svn/trunk@2332 8db76d5a-ed1c-0410-87a9-c151d255dfc7\n",
  "tree_diff": [
    {
      "type": "modify",
      "old_id": "97b1e4ca65b286a9679e8524c32495efb5b127ff",
      "old_mode": 33188,
      "old_path": "user/src/com/google/gwt/user/client/ui/PopupPanel.java",
      "new_id": "79361dc64cce86df9e4b77ec73f89efefabdba26",
      "new_mode": 33188,
      "new_path": "user/src/com/google/gwt/user/client/ui/PopupPanel.java"
    },
    {
      "type": "modify",
      "old_id": "74177fa8b9e51a34f59c884bdcf8c9691ba1f773",
      "old_mode": 33188,
      "old_path": "user/src/com/google/gwt/user/client/ui/PrefixTree.java",
      "new_id": "be84f89c32e0c3e507defb6656cfc244929bc03d",
      "new_mode": 33188,
      "new_path": "user/src/com/google/gwt/user/client/ui/PrefixTree.java"
    },
    {
      "type": "modify",
      "old_id": "d0bb0b25f4c5d17af066acafdd3ea75701f2f4b7",
      "old_mode": 33188,
      "old_path": "user/src/com/google/gwt/user/client/ui/StackPanel.java",
      "new_id": "a70de0cd754d47ad7b634d0935b73e1142e570f8",
      "new_mode": 33188,
      "new_path": "user/src/com/google/gwt/user/client/ui/StackPanel.java"
    },
    {
      "type": "modify",
      "old_id": "29dd10f29364e8bcdfd846bcbc5834c35497842f",
      "old_mode": 33188,
      "old_path": "user/super/com/google/gwt/emul/java/util/Arrays.java",
      "new_id": "06789b56992cefebf38aceff708e8b751ca7958d",
      "new_mode": 33188,
      "new_path": "user/super/com/google/gwt/emul/java/util/Arrays.java"
    },
    {
      "type": "modify",
      "old_id": "c9f778d76f79d20b84c7a4b3a30e5d1f2dcf8362",
      "old_mode": 33188,
      "old_path": "user/super/com/google/gwt/emul/java/util/Collections.java",
      "new_id": "252236b62aa7ccebba1c965abc4ef595906359f8",
      "new_mode": 33188,
      "new_path": "user/super/com/google/gwt/emul/java/util/Collections.java"
    },
    {
      "type": "modify",
      "old_id": "03079d95f02cea279198a6b4b81325e7ea74b7f0",
      "old_mode": 33188,
      "old_path": "user/super/com/google/gwt/emul/java/util/PriorityQueue.java",
      "new_id": "48962e574db6fd4feac59607c90be738ad142ed6",
      "new_mode": 33188,
      "new_path": "user/super/com/google/gwt/emul/java/util/PriorityQueue.java"
    }
  ]
}
